Dr. David Mitlin

David Mitlin is a Cockrell Endowed Professor at the Walker Department of Mechanical Engineering, The University of Texas at Austin. Prior to that, he was a Professor and General Electric Chair at Clarkson University, and an Assistant, Associate and full Professor at the University of Alberta, Alberta Canada. Dr. Mitlin is an ISI Highly Cited Researcher, having published about 175 journal articles on various aspects of energy storage materials, on metallurgy and corrosion. He also holds 15 granted U.S. patents and 18 more pending full applications, with all of them licensed currently or in the past. He has presented around 125 invited, keynote and plenary talks at various international conferences. Dr. Mitlin is an Associate Editor for Sustainable Energy and Fuels, a Royal Society of Chemistry Journal focused on renewables. He received a Doctorate in Materials Science from U.C. Berkeley in 2000, a M.S. from Penn State in 1996, and a B.S. from RPI in 1995.

Leigang Xue
  • Co-Founder of Group1 focusing on commercialization of K-ion batteries.
  • Key technical member in 2 startups as a Principal battery scientist, the developed Silicon-anode materials and non-flammable electrolyte have enabled raising +$100M VC funding.
  • Established KIB battery program in Dr. John Goodenough Lab. Inventor of K2MnFe(CN)6 cathode and room-temperature liquid Na-K anode technology with Dr. John Goodenough.
  • Author of 70+ journal papers and hold 12 granted battery patents.
  • PhD in Physical Chemistry (Fudan University)
